Output 15a8851036b3176859f50f983cc00667c30134cf7f35da3f37fc29d912691571:24

value
1653
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40c174c028267859058b6d024ef036a4e18a02f611fe584811bf4dbbcbf57d1e
address
bc1pgrqhfspgyeu9jpvtd5pyaupk5nsc5qhkz8l9sjq3haxmhjl4050qgn2w97
transaction
15a8851036b3176859f50f983cc00667c30134cf7f35da3f37fc29d912691571
spent
true